Re: Mitutoyo M Plan APO HR 5X 0.21 Test Results

If you're talking about half-pixel shift then yes, greatly diminished aliasing. That sort of shifting does not change the MTF curves as computed here, but it does double the sampling frequency so it doubles the Nyquist limit.
